    • Open the paper trail

    • Get your screw driver with a Philips bit (from your Pro Tech Toolkit for instance) and unscrew the four screws at each corner

    • Unclip lid delicately with the help of a guitar pick or with the Jimmy tool.

  2. Zink Polaroid ZIP Wireless Mobile Photo Mini Printer Battery Replacement, Unplug battery: step 2, image 1 of 1
    • Unplug the battery pack and remove it

    • You can also see the internals of this device directly on the FCC ID website.

    • Remove the foam padding from the battery

    • Optional: use a warming element like the bed of your 3D printer or iFixit iOpener

    • Place the foam on your new battery

  4. Zink Polaroid ZIP Wireless Mobile Photo Mini Printer Battery Replacement, Make sure connector's wires are matching: step 4, image 1 of 1
    • Make sure the connector of your new battery pack is matching the one you remove

    • If it's not matching, for each wrong pin:

    • Push down pin in the cover part of the connector

    • Pull on the pin to extract it from connector

    • Place it back in right spot

  5. Zink Polaroid ZIP Wireless Mobile Photo Mini Printer Battery Replacement, Plug new battery pack: step 5, image 1 of 1
    • Place and plug new battery pack

    • Plug device with USB mini cable and test device is charging

    • If blinking red, unplug immediately and verify polarity of your battery pack

    • If the LED indicator stays red-still for more than 60 seconds, you replaced the battery successfully! 🎉

    • Clip lid back and put back the screws

    • Charge battery fully, until LED turns green, before using.
